Output c3029cbb94794ca334280c363f19a661a675dd36e11836eccbd7df26ff3e85b4:1

value
11481888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ddafdf962106da1a4f90e38d20a1c5fb7b3de244 OP_EQUAL
address
3MuBwqQ5ZYWA7kyTAE5kHve77LdjqANm72
transaction
c3029cbb94794ca334280c363f19a661a675dd36e11836eccbd7df26ff3e85b4
confirmations
476944
spent
true